卡盟辅助登录

探索编程辅助软件:高效代码编写与项目管理的得力助手

卡盟 辅助资讯
卡盟辅助登录

在当今数字化的时代,编程已经成为推动科技发展的重要力量。从简单的脚本编写到复杂的大型软件系统开发,编程工作涉及到众多的环节和技术细节。而编程辅助软件在其中扮演着至关重要的角色,它就像是程序员们手中的得力工具,极大地提高了编程的效率和质量。

编程辅助软件种类繁多,功能也各有侧重。首先是集成开发环境(IDE),这是最为常见的编程辅助工具之一。像 Visual Studio、IntelliJ IDEA 等,它们集成了代码编辑器、编译器、调试器等多种功能,为程序员提供了一站式的开发环境。在 Visual Studio 中,开发者可以方便地进行代码的编写、调试和测试,它支持多种编程语言,如 C#、Python、JavaScript 等。IDE 中的代码自动补全功能能够根据程序员输入的部分代码,智能地预测并提供可能的代码选项,大大减少了代码输入的时间和错误率。调试功能也十分强大,程序员可以设置断点,逐行执行代码,观察变量的值和程序的执行流程,快速定位和解决代码中的问题。

代码管理工具也是编程辅助软件的重要组成部分。Git 作为一款分布式版本控制系统,被广泛应用于软件开发项目中。它允许程序员对代码进行版本管理,记录代码的每一次修改,方便团队成员之间的协作开发。通过 Git,不同的开发者可以在自己的本地分支上进行代码开发,然后将修改合并到主分支上。这样,即使在多人同时开发的情况下,也能保证代码的一致性和可追溯性。而且,Git 还支持代码的回滚操作,如果在开发过程中出现了问题,可以轻松地将代码恢复到之前的某个版本。

探索编程辅助软件:高效代码编写与项目管理的得力助手

除此之外,还有专门的代码格式化工具。在编程过程中,代码的格式规范非常重要,它不仅影响代码的可读性,还关系到团队协作的效率。像 Prettier 这样的代码格式化工具,可以自动对代码进行格式化,统一代码的风格。无论是空格的使用、缩进的方式还是代码的分行,Prettier 都能按照预设的规则进行处理,使得代码看起来更加整洁、规范。这对于大型项目的开发尤为重要,因为不同的开发者可能有不同的编码习惯,使用代码格式化工具可以确保整个项目的代码风格一致。

代码分析工具也为编程工作提供了有力的支持。SonarQube 就是一款强大的代码分析工具,它可以对代码进行静态分析,检测代码中的潜在问题,如代码漏洞、代码异味等。通过对代码的质量进行评估,开发者可以及时发现并解决代码中的问题,提高代码的可靠性和安全性。而且,SonarQube 还能生成详细的分析报告,帮助开发者了解代码的整体状况,为代码的优化提供参考。

在移动开发领域,也有许多实用的编程辅助软件。例如 Android Studio 专门用于 Android 应用的开发,它提供了丰富的开发工具和资源,如布局编辑器、模拟器等。通过布局编辑器,开发者可以直观地设计 Android 应用的界面,而模拟器则可以模拟不同的 Android 设备环境,方便开发者进行应用的测试和调试。

随着人工智能技术的发展,一些基于 AI 的编程辅助软件也逐渐崭露头角。这些软件可以根据开发者输入的自然语言描述,生成相应的代码。它们能够理解开发者的意图,从大量的代码库中筛选出合适的代码片段,并进行适当的修改和优化。这对于初学者来说尤为有用,可以帮助他们快速上手编程,同时也能为有经验的开发者提供新的思路和解决方案。

编程辅助软件已经成为现代编程工作中不可或缺的一部分。它们从不同的方面为程序员提供了帮助,提高了编程的效率和质量,推动了软件开发行业的不断发展。无论是个人开发者还是大型软件开发团队,都离不开这些强大的编程辅助工具。在未来,随着技术的不断进步,编程辅助软件也将不断升级和完善,为编程工作带来更多的便利和惊喜。

卡盟辅助登录
0 5